BACOLOD CITY – A couple was arrested with 120 grams of suspected shabu valued at PHP 816,000 in Barangay II-Poblacion, Pontevedra, Negros Occidental, on Wednesday.
Police identified the suspects as “Chris,” 50, of Kabankalan City, and his live-in partner “Rufa,” 36, of Binalbagan town.
Police Capt. Darryl Kuhutan, chief of the Pontevedra Municipal Police Station, said Chris was the subject of the operation and had been tagged as a high-value individual.
Kuhutan said the couple allegedly conspired to sell the illegal drugs and were reportedly caught repacking the substance during the operation.
The buy-bust was initiated following a tip from a former customer who claimed the suspects were actively selling illegal drugs in the town, according to a report from the Police Regional Office–Negros Island Region (PRO–NIR).
Kuhutan said the couple had been renting an apartment in Pontevedra for three months, and police had received multiple complaints regarding their suspected activity.
He added that both suspects had previously faced charges for drug-related offenses.
PRO–NIR urged the public to remain vigilant and report any information related to illegal drug operations in their communities.
